What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ps you triage potential IP infringement risk so you can quickly see which facts and legal factors cut toward your position or the other side, without overstating conclusions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Multi-right IP triage: Supports trade mark, copyright, patent, and trade secret/confidential information assessments, including mixed scenarios run separately.
  • Fact-driven flag lists: Produces a structured set of factors (what helps the senior party, what helps the accused, and what is mixed), plus defence/threshold flags.
  • Enforcement routing with guardrails: Surfaces unjustified threats risk and recommends next steps and downstream handoffs (e.g., cease-and-desist or takedown) only via explicit gated skills and practice-profile posture.
